Mahabharata Vana Parva – दवेष्यॊ न साधुर भवति न मेधावी न पण्डितः

Shloka (श्लोक)

दवेष्यॊ न साधुर भवति न मेधावी न पण्डितः
परिये शुभानि कर्माणि दवेष्ये पापानि भारत

Translations

English Translation

A malicious person cannot be righteous; neither the clever nor the learned can exhibit goodness. Those who harbor enmity will only perform sinful deeds.

Commentary

Context

This verse explains the fundamental nature of individuals affected by negativity.

Meaning

It indicates that harboring negativity leads to a character devoid of virtue, impacting one’s actions.

Application

This shloka reminds us to cultivate positive thoughts to engage in righteous actions and avoid negativity.
